Keele University is the Top 10 university in England for student satisfaction, 2nd for Physiotherapy and Radiography, 4th for Medicine behind only Oxford, Cambridge, and Brighton Sussex Medical School, and Top 10 for Geography.
(Source: Guardian League Table, 2021)
Here are some more facts about Keele:
- Consistently ranked in the top three in England for student satisfaction (of broad-based universities), NSS 2014-2019
- Top 175 in the world for Psychology, Top 250 for Social Sciences, and Top 300 for Education subjects (2020 Times Higher Education World University)
- £45 million invested to redevelop our Science, Technology, Engineering and Maths facilities on campus
- 96% of our graduates were in a job or further study six months following graduation (DLHE, 2017)

Bursaries & Scholarships
Postgraduate Funding Opportunities
- Keele International Excellence Scholarship (PGT): up to £5,000 based on undergraduate degree award
- Developing Countries Scholarship: £1,000 for students who are nationals of the least developed, low and lower-middle-income countries (as defined by the World Bank)
- GREAT Scholarships 2021 – Asia: 15 nos of £10,000 scholarships for Master’s study in select courses (external awards)
Undergraduate Funding Opportunities
- Keele International Excellence Scholarship (UG): £2,500 per year for students exceeding published entry requirements
- Developing Countries Scholarship (UG): £1,000 per year for students who are nationals of the least developed, low and lower-middle-income countries (as defined by the World Bank)
